UN agriculture project to help farmers in Nuba Mountains region of Sudan

June 07, 2004

Sudan - About 150,000 people in Sudan's troubled Nuba Mountains region have received seeds, tools and construction materials as part of a scheme by the United Nations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) to rehabilitate the area's farming industry.

The project - which aims to revive degraded agricultural land, create dams and build up stores of seeds - is designed to benefit farmers living on both sides of the long-running civil conflict between the Sudanese Government and the Sudan People's Liberation Movement (SPLM).
